Trombone Shorty & Orleans Avenue Announced As Special Guest For Lenny Kravitz In New Zealand

06 March 2020 - 0 Comments

On the back of Australia’s Byron Bay Bluesfest, TEG Live is pleased to announce that Trombone Shorty & Orleans Avenue will be joining one of the most successful and best-selling artists of his generation, Lenny Kravitz, for his first ever New Zealand show at Auckland’s Spark Arena on March 31.Tickets are now on sale from Ticketmaster.

Trombone Shorty aka Troy Andrews is a musician, producer and actor who first performed with Kravitz as part of the horn section on his 2005 tour. Troy Andrews is the bandleader and frontman of Trombone Shorty & Orleans Avenue, a nine-piece hard-edged funk band that employs brass-band beats, rock dynamics and improvisation in a jazz tradition.

Andrews has gone on to work with some of the biggest names in rock, pop, jazz, funk and hip hop including, Prince, U2, Green Day, Charles Neville (Neville Brothers), Rod Stewart, Eric Clapton, Mark Ronson, Zhu, Bone Thugs N Harmony, Rebirth Brass Band, Pee Wee Ellis, Fred Wesley and Maceo Parker,and has shared the stage with Hall & Oates, the Red Hot Chili Peppers, Steven Tyler, LeAnn Rimes, Macklemore & Ryan Lewis, Madonna, and the Foo Fighters.

Andrews has performed at the White House five times between 2008-2016, a highlight being in 2012 as part of Black History Month, alongside B.B. King, Jeff Beck, Keb' Mo', Mick Jagger, Michelle Obama and twice again in 2015 (for President Obama) with Usher, Queen Latifah, Crosby, Stills and Nash and Aloe Blacc.

Best known as a trombone, trumpet player and singer, Andrews also plays drums, organ, and tuba and is the younger brother of trumpeter and bandleader James Andrews and the grandson of singer and songwriter Jessie Hill. The late Travis "Trumpet Black’ Hill is another musical family member.

Trombone Shorty & Orleans Avenue promises a unique musical union of rock n roll, funk, blues and soul with New Orleans jazz and hip hop which will get the audience ready for Lenny Kravitz, who will bring the house down with his high energy show featuring this classic hits and new music from Rise Vibration album
